excel里函数if怎么用
作者:excel百科网
|
255人看过
发布时间:2026-01-07 12:18:10
标签:
Excel中IF函数的使用详解:从基础到进阶在Excel中,IF函数是一个非常常用的条件判断函数,它能够根据特定条件判断某个值是否成立,并返回相应的结果。无论是日常的数据处理,还是复杂的财务计算,IF函数都是不可或缺的工具。下面将详细
Excel中IF函数的使用详解:从基础到进阶
在Excel中,IF函数是一个非常常用的条件判断函数,它能够根据特定条件判断某个值是否成立,并返回相应的结果。无论是日常的数据处理,还是复杂的财务计算,IF函数都是不可或缺的工具。下面将详细介绍IF函数的使用方法、常见应用场景以及一些高级技巧,帮助用户更高效地掌握这一功能。
一、IF函数的基本结构
IF函数的基本语法如下:
=IF(判断条件, 如果条件成立返回的值, 如果条件不成立返回的值)
其中:
- `判断条件`:用于判断的表达式,可以是数值、文本、函数、逻辑运算符等。
- `如果条件成立返回的值`:当判断条件为真时,返回的值。
- `如果条件不成立返回的值`:当判断条件为假时,返回的值。
例如:
=IF(A1>10, "大于10", "小于等于10")
这个公式的意思是,如果A1单元格的值大于10,则显示“大于10”,否则显示“小于等于10”。
二、IF函数的常见应用场景
1. 条件判断与简单结果返回
IF函数最基础的用途是进行简单的条件判断,返回不同的结果。
示例:
=IF(B2>100, "优秀", IF(B2>80, "良好", "及格"))
这个公式的意思是,如果B2单元格的值大于100,显示“优秀”;如果小于100但大于80,显示“良好”;如果小于等于80,显示“及格”。
2. 条件判断与多级结果返回
IF函数可以嵌套使用,实现多级判断,适用于更复杂的条件逻辑。
示例:
=IF(A1>50, "优秀", IF(A1>40, "良好", "一般"))
这个公式的意思是,如果A1单元格的值大于50,显示“优秀”;如果小于50但大于40,显示“良好”;否则显示“一般”。
3. 条件判断与文本返回
IF函数可以用于文本判断,适用于分类、统计等场景。
示例:
=IF(C2="A", "优秀", IF(C2="B", "良好", "普通"))
这个公式的意思是,如果C2单元格的值为“A”,显示“优秀”;如果为“B”,显示“良好”;否则显示“普通”。
三、IF函数的应用场景分析
1. 数据统计与分类
IF函数在数据统计中非常常见,用于对数据进行分类和统计。
示例:
=IF(D2>1000, "高", IF(D2>500, "中", "低"))
这个公式可以用于统计销售额,根据销售额的高低进行分类。
2. 财务计算
在财务计算中,IF函数可以用于判断是否满足某个条件,例如是否需要支付利息、是否需要扣税等。
示例:
=IF(E2>10000, E20.05, E20.03)
这个公式的意思是,如果E2单元格的值大于10000,按5%计算利息;否则按3%计算利息。
3. 数据验证与错误处理
IF函数也可以用于数据验证,确保输入的数据符合特定条件。
示例:
=IF(F2<0, "输入错误", G2)
这个公式的意思是,如果F2单元格的值小于0,显示“输入错误”,否则显示G2单元格的值。
四、IF函数的高级用法
1. 嵌套IF函数
IF函数可以嵌套使用,实现更复杂的条件判断。
示例:
=IF(A1>100, "优秀", IF(A1>80, "良好", IF(A1>60, "及格", "不及格")))
这个公式的意思是,如果A1单元格的值大于100,显示“优秀”;如果小于100但大于80,显示“良好”;如果小于80但大于60,显示“及格”;否则显示“不及格”。
2. 使用逻辑运算符
IF函数可以与逻辑运算符(如AND、OR)结合使用,实现更复杂的条件判断。
示例:
=IF(AND(A1>100, B1>200), "满足条件", "不满足条件")
这个公式的意思是,如果A1和B1的值都大于100和200,显示“满足条件”,否则显示“不满足条件”。
3. 使用函数返回值
IF函数还可以返回函数的结果,实现更复杂的计算。
示例:
=IF(C2>100, D2+E2, D2)
这个公式的意思是,如果C2单元格的值大于100,返回D2+E2的和;否则返回D2的值。
五、IF函数的常见错误与解决方法
1. 条件表达式错误
在使用IF函数时,如果条件表达式错误,会导致公式不生效。
解决方法:
确保条件表达式正确,例如使用正确的比较运算符(如>、<、=)和逻辑运算符(如AND、OR)。
2. 条件判断逻辑错误
如果条件判断逻辑错误,可能导致公式返回错误的结果。
解决方法:
检查条件判断的顺序和逻辑关系,确保判断的先后顺序和条件语句的正确性。
3. 公式错误
如果公式中的单元格引用错误,会导致公式无法正确计算。
解决方法:
确保公式中的单元格引用正确,避免使用无效的单元格地址。
六、IF函数的使用技巧
1. 使用IF函数进行数据分类
IF函数可以用于对数据进行分类,适用于分类统计、分配任务等场景。
示例:
=IF(E2<1000, "低", IF(E2<2000, "中", "高"))
这个公式可以用于对销售额进行分类,根据销售额的高低进行不同的处理。
2. 使用IF函数进行条件判断
IF函数可以与多个条件结合使用,实现更复杂的条件判断。
示例:
=IF(A1>100, "优秀", IF(A1>80, "良好", "一般"))
这个公式可以用于对成绩进行分类,根据成绩的高低进行不同的处理。
3. 使用IF函数进行数据验证
IF函数可以用于数据验证,确保输入的数据符合特定条件。
示例:
=IF(F2<0, "输入错误", G2)
这个公式可以用于验证输入数据是否为正数,如果为负数,显示错误信息。
七、IF函数的进阶使用
1. 结合其他函数使用
IF函数可以与其他函数结合使用,实现更复杂的计算。
示例:
=IF(A1>100, B1+C1, B1)
这个公式的意思是,如果A1单元格的值大于100,返回B1+C1的和;否则返回B1的值。
2. 使用IF函数进行多条件判断
IF函数可以用于多条件判断,适用于复杂的数据处理。
示例:
=IF(AND(A1>100, B1>200), "满足条件", "不满足条件")
这个公式的意思是,如果A1和B1的值都大于100和200,显示“满足条件”,否则显示“不满足条件”。
3. 使用IF函数进行多级判断
IF函数可以用于多级判断,适用于更复杂的条件逻辑。
示例:
=IF(A1>100, "优秀", IF(A1>80, "良好", IF(A1>60, "及格", "不及格")))
这个公式的意思是,如果A1单元格的值大于100,显示“优秀”;如果小于100但大于80,显示“良好”;如果小于80但大于60,显示“及格”;否则显示“不及格”。
八、IF函数的优化技巧
1. 使用IF函数替代IFERROR函数
在某些情况下,IF函数可以替代IFERROR函数,实现更简洁的条件判断。
示例:
=IF(A1>100, "优秀", "其他")
这个公式可以替代IFERROR函数,避免公式出错。
2. 使用IF函数进行条件判断时避免重复计算
在条件判断中,避免重复计算可以提高效率。
示例:
=IF(A1>100, B1+C1, B1)
这个公式可以避免重复计算,提高效率。
3. 使用IF函数进行条件判断时避免条件逻辑错误
在条件判断中,确保逻辑关系正确,避免错误。
示例:
=IF(AND(A1>100, B1>200), "满足条件", "不满足条件")
这个公式可以避免逻辑错误,确保条件判断的正确性。
九、IF函数的常见误区
1. 条件表达式错误
在使用IF函数时,如果条件表达式错误,会导致公式不生效。
解决方法:
确保条件表达式正确,如使用正确的比较运算符和逻辑运算符。
2. 条件判断逻辑错误
如果条件判断逻辑错误,可能导致公式返回错误的结果。
解决方法:
检查条件判断的顺序和逻辑关系,确保判断的先后顺序和条件语句的正确性。
3. 公式错误
如果公式中的单元格引用错误,会导致公式无法正确计算。
解决方法:
确保公式中的单元格引用正确,避免使用无效的单元格地址。
十、IF函数的总结
IF函数是Excel中一个非常有用且灵活的函数,它能够根据条件判断返回不同的结果,适用于数据统计、分类、财务计算、数据验证等多个场景。通过掌握IF函数的使用方法和技巧,用户可以更高效地处理数据,提高工作效率。
掌握IF函数不仅能够帮助用户提高Excel操作水平,还能在实际工作中发挥重要作用。无论是简单的条件判断,还是复杂的多级条件判断,IF函数都能提供强大的支持。用户可以根据实际需求灵活运用IF函数,实现更高效的数据处理。
在Excel中,IF函数是一个不可或缺的工具,它的使用能够帮助用户更灵活地处理数据,提高工作效率。通过掌握IF函数的使用方法和技巧,用户可以更高效地完成数据处理任务,实现更精确的统计和分析。希望本文能够帮助用户更好地理解和应用IF函数,提升在Excel中的操作水平。
在Excel中,IF函数是一个非常常用的条件判断函数,它能够根据特定条件判断某个值是否成立,并返回相应的结果。无论是日常的数据处理,还是复杂的财务计算,IF函数都是不可或缺的工具。下面将详细介绍IF函数的使用方法、常见应用场景以及一些高级技巧,帮助用户更高效地掌握这一功能。
一、IF函数的基本结构
IF函数的基本语法如下:
=IF(判断条件, 如果条件成立返回的值, 如果条件不成立返回的值)
其中:
- `判断条件`:用于判断的表达式,可以是数值、文本、函数、逻辑运算符等。
- `如果条件成立返回的值`:当判断条件为真时,返回的值。
- `如果条件不成立返回的值`:当判断条件为假时,返回的值。
例如:
=IF(A1>10, "大于10", "小于等于10")
这个公式的意思是,如果A1单元格的值大于10,则显示“大于10”,否则显示“小于等于10”。
二、IF函数的常见应用场景
1. 条件判断与简单结果返回
IF函数最基础的用途是进行简单的条件判断,返回不同的结果。
示例:
=IF(B2>100, "优秀", IF(B2>80, "良好", "及格"))
这个公式的意思是,如果B2单元格的值大于100,显示“优秀”;如果小于100但大于80,显示“良好”;如果小于等于80,显示“及格”。
2. 条件判断与多级结果返回
IF函数可以嵌套使用,实现多级判断,适用于更复杂的条件逻辑。
示例:
=IF(A1>50, "优秀", IF(A1>40, "良好", "一般"))
这个公式的意思是,如果A1单元格的值大于50,显示“优秀”;如果小于50但大于40,显示“良好”;否则显示“一般”。
3. 条件判断与文本返回
IF函数可以用于文本判断,适用于分类、统计等场景。
示例:
=IF(C2="A", "优秀", IF(C2="B", "良好", "普通"))
这个公式的意思是,如果C2单元格的值为“A”,显示“优秀”;如果为“B”,显示“良好”;否则显示“普通”。
三、IF函数的应用场景分析
1. 数据统计与分类
IF函数在数据统计中非常常见,用于对数据进行分类和统计。
示例:
=IF(D2>1000, "高", IF(D2>500, "中", "低"))
这个公式可以用于统计销售额,根据销售额的高低进行分类。
2. 财务计算
在财务计算中,IF函数可以用于判断是否满足某个条件,例如是否需要支付利息、是否需要扣税等。
示例:
=IF(E2>10000, E20.05, E20.03)
这个公式的意思是,如果E2单元格的值大于10000,按5%计算利息;否则按3%计算利息。
3. 数据验证与错误处理
IF函数也可以用于数据验证,确保输入的数据符合特定条件。
示例:
=IF(F2<0, "输入错误", G2)
这个公式的意思是,如果F2单元格的值小于0,显示“输入错误”,否则显示G2单元格的值。
四、IF函数的高级用法
1. 嵌套IF函数
IF函数可以嵌套使用,实现更复杂的条件判断。
示例:
=IF(A1>100, "优秀", IF(A1>80, "良好", IF(A1>60, "及格", "不及格")))
这个公式的意思是,如果A1单元格的值大于100,显示“优秀”;如果小于100但大于80,显示“良好”;如果小于80但大于60,显示“及格”;否则显示“不及格”。
2. 使用逻辑运算符
IF函数可以与逻辑运算符(如AND、OR)结合使用,实现更复杂的条件判断。
示例:
=IF(AND(A1>100, B1>200), "满足条件", "不满足条件")
这个公式的意思是,如果A1和B1的值都大于100和200,显示“满足条件”,否则显示“不满足条件”。
3. 使用函数返回值
IF函数还可以返回函数的结果,实现更复杂的计算。
示例:
=IF(C2>100, D2+E2, D2)
这个公式的意思是,如果C2单元格的值大于100,返回D2+E2的和;否则返回D2的值。
五、IF函数的常见错误与解决方法
1. 条件表达式错误
在使用IF函数时,如果条件表达式错误,会导致公式不生效。
解决方法:
确保条件表达式正确,例如使用正确的比较运算符(如>、<、=)和逻辑运算符(如AND、OR)。
2. 条件判断逻辑错误
如果条件判断逻辑错误,可能导致公式返回错误的结果。
解决方法:
检查条件判断的顺序和逻辑关系,确保判断的先后顺序和条件语句的正确性。
3. 公式错误
如果公式中的单元格引用错误,会导致公式无法正确计算。
解决方法:
确保公式中的单元格引用正确,避免使用无效的单元格地址。
六、IF函数的使用技巧
1. 使用IF函数进行数据分类
IF函数可以用于对数据进行分类,适用于分类统计、分配任务等场景。
示例:
=IF(E2<1000, "低", IF(E2<2000, "中", "高"))
这个公式可以用于对销售额进行分类,根据销售额的高低进行不同的处理。
2. 使用IF函数进行条件判断
IF函数可以与多个条件结合使用,实现更复杂的条件判断。
示例:
=IF(A1>100, "优秀", IF(A1>80, "良好", "一般"))
这个公式可以用于对成绩进行分类,根据成绩的高低进行不同的处理。
3. 使用IF函数进行数据验证
IF函数可以用于数据验证,确保输入的数据符合特定条件。
示例:
=IF(F2<0, "输入错误", G2)
这个公式可以用于验证输入数据是否为正数,如果为负数,显示错误信息。
七、IF函数的进阶使用
1. 结合其他函数使用
IF函数可以与其他函数结合使用,实现更复杂的计算。
示例:
=IF(A1>100, B1+C1, B1)
这个公式的意思是,如果A1单元格的值大于100,返回B1+C1的和;否则返回B1的值。
2. 使用IF函数进行多条件判断
IF函数可以用于多条件判断,适用于复杂的数据处理。
示例:
=IF(AND(A1>100, B1>200), "满足条件", "不满足条件")
这个公式的意思是,如果A1和B1的值都大于100和200,显示“满足条件”,否则显示“不满足条件”。
3. 使用IF函数进行多级判断
IF函数可以用于多级判断,适用于更复杂的条件逻辑。
示例:
=IF(A1>100, "优秀", IF(A1>80, "良好", IF(A1>60, "及格", "不及格")))
这个公式的意思是,如果A1单元格的值大于100,显示“优秀”;如果小于100但大于80,显示“良好”;如果小于80但大于60,显示“及格”;否则显示“不及格”。
八、IF函数的优化技巧
1. 使用IF函数替代IFERROR函数
在某些情况下,IF函数可以替代IFERROR函数,实现更简洁的条件判断。
示例:
=IF(A1>100, "优秀", "其他")
这个公式可以替代IFERROR函数,避免公式出错。
2. 使用IF函数进行条件判断时避免重复计算
在条件判断中,避免重复计算可以提高效率。
示例:
=IF(A1>100, B1+C1, B1)
这个公式可以避免重复计算,提高效率。
3. 使用IF函数进行条件判断时避免条件逻辑错误
在条件判断中,确保逻辑关系正确,避免错误。
示例:
=IF(AND(A1>100, B1>200), "满足条件", "不满足条件")
这个公式可以避免逻辑错误,确保条件判断的正确性。
九、IF函数的常见误区
1. 条件表达式错误
在使用IF函数时,如果条件表达式错误,会导致公式不生效。
解决方法:
确保条件表达式正确,如使用正确的比较运算符和逻辑运算符。
2. 条件判断逻辑错误
如果条件判断逻辑错误,可能导致公式返回错误的结果。
解决方法:
检查条件判断的顺序和逻辑关系,确保判断的先后顺序和条件语句的正确性。
3. 公式错误
如果公式中的单元格引用错误,会导致公式无法正确计算。
解决方法:
确保公式中的单元格引用正确,避免使用无效的单元格地址。
十、IF函数的总结
IF函数是Excel中一个非常有用且灵活的函数,它能够根据条件判断返回不同的结果,适用于数据统计、分类、财务计算、数据验证等多个场景。通过掌握IF函数的使用方法和技巧,用户可以更高效地处理数据,提高工作效率。
掌握IF函数不仅能够帮助用户提高Excel操作水平,还能在实际工作中发挥重要作用。无论是简单的条件判断,还是复杂的多级条件判断,IF函数都能提供强大的支持。用户可以根据实际需求灵活运用IF函数,实现更高效的数据处理。
在Excel中,IF函数是一个不可或缺的工具,它的使用能够帮助用户更灵活地处理数据,提高工作效率。通过掌握IF函数的使用方法和技巧,用户可以更高效地完成数据处理任务,实现更精确的统计和分析。希望本文能够帮助用户更好地理解和应用IF函数,提升在Excel中的操作水平。
推荐文章
excel数据如何分组显示在Excel中,数据的分组显示是提高数据处理效率的重要手段。通过分组,用户可以将数据按照特定条件进行分类,从而更直观地分析和操作数据。本文将从数据分组的基本概念入手,详细介绍Excel中分组显示的实现方法,并
2026-01-07 12:17:40
336人看过
Excel表格保护密码忘记了怎么办?深度解析与实用指南在日常办公或个人数据管理中,Excel表格的保护功能是一项非常重要且常见的设置。它能有效防止他人随意更改数据,保护用户隐私和工作成果。然而,当用户忘记Excel表格的保护密码时,往
2026-01-07 12:17:05
233人看过
Excel批量单元格内容合并:实战技巧与深度解析在Excel中,数据的整理和处理是日常工作中的重要环节。尤其是当数据量较大时,手动合并单元格不仅效率低下,还容易出错。因此,掌握Excel中批量单元格内容合并的技巧,对于提升工作效率、减
2026-01-07 12:17:05
96人看过
excel数据批量提取到excel的实用指南在数据处理领域,Excel 是一个不可或缺的工具。它不仅能够满足日常的数据整理、计算和分析需求,还能通过各种操作实现数据的批量提取和导入。本文将围绕“excel数据批量提取到excel”的主
2026-01-07 12:16:56
407人看过


.webp)
